Reports: Milan Futuro close to signing Roma goalkeeper – the formula and figures

AC Milan are not just working on signing a goalkeeper for the first team but also a new option for the Futuro, with Davide Mastrantonio possibly arrived.

Milan already have several young goalkeepers ready to fight to earn a place both in the Milan Futuro and possibly as third-choice goalkeeper of the first team.

There is Lapo Nava who has already made his Serie A debut, the UEFA Youth League hero Noah Raveyre and Lorenzo Torriani who is out in the USA for preseason.

Going even younger than that, Alessandro Longoni is very highly rated and he was a protagonist along with Francesco Camarda in the Italy U17 side that won the European Championship just a few weeks ago.

According to Tuttosport and Nicolò Schira (via Radio Rossonera), Milan Futuro are very close to signing Davide Mastrantonio from Roma. He was a European champion in 2023 with Alberto Bollini’s Under 19s and his agent is Federico Pastorello.

Why is that significant? It is the same agent who is negotiating with the Milan directors to bring Simone Scuffet from Cagliari, another of his clients, to the Rossoneri as Mike Maignan’s deputy while Marco Sportiello’s injury heals.

For Mastrantonio it will apparently be loan with option to buy for €150k, with Roma keeping the possibility of a buy-back for €300k. Last season, the teenager played on loan in Serie C for Pro Vercelli and Guidonia.
